Output 3f20d8a99312e095686edd9998590ca6bf2014d6ea54239a38d87f8cbbbc3e7a:0

value
4249663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8daebde52fb5a945611f996c51aa985c360f38 OP_EQUAL
address
3HbyECbsqQzdoRFMkbfuCnsfX8xUCfftUE
transaction
3f20d8a99312e095686edd9998590ca6bf2014d6ea54239a38d87f8cbbbc3e7a
confirmations
332562
spent
true